Not when the resource is ready. … WebJul 22, 2024 · What are 5 push and pull factors? Push and pull factors. Economic migration – to find work or follow a particular career path. Social migration – for a better quality of life or to be closer to family or friends. Political migration – to escape political persecution or war. According to eschooltoday.com, “Push factors are those that force the individual to move voluntarily, and in many cases, they are forced because the individual risk something if they stay. Push factors may include conflict, drought, famine, or extreme religious activity.”.
